Mr. Jean Yves Aristide Yao, Université de Bourgogne Europe, France

Jean Yves Aristide Yao is a lecturer and researcher in computer science, currently pursuing a Ph.D. at the University of Burgundy, France, specializing in image processing and instrumentation. With a strong academic background in mathematics, computer science, and image analysis from institutions in Morocco and France, he has extensive teaching experience at both the University of Burgundy and the Virtual University of Côte d’Ivoire. His research focuses on enhancing the spatial resolution of images captured by one-shot multispectral filter array (MSFA) cameras, addressing challenges in multispectral image demosaicking. He has published work in peer-reviewed journals and is developing innovative methods to optimize image quality through spectral band composition and mechanical acquisition systems. In addition to his research, Jean Yves has contributed to pedagogical innovation at the Agence Universitaire de la Francophonie, and is proficient in a wide range of programming languages and educational technologies. His work bridges software development, image science, and digital education.

Prof. Chavis Srichan ,Faculty of Engineering, Khon Kaen University ,Thailand

Dr. Chavis Srichan has a diverse academic and professional background in computer engineering and microelectronics. He received his Bachelor’s degree with First Class Honors and as a Gold Medalist from Khon Kaen University in 2002. His pursuit of advanced studies took him to Technische Universitat Hamburg, Germany, where he earned his Master’s degree in Microelectronics and Microsystems with distinction in 2006. Following this, he completed his Doctor of Engineering in Microelectronics and Embedded Systems at the Asian Institute of Technology in 2018.Dr. Srichan’s career has been marked by significant contributions to research and academia. He has held various positions, including software developer roles at MRI Laboratory, Khon Kaen University, and SIEMENS AG Munich, Germany. His research interests span printed electronics, nanoelectronics, MEMS, and embedded systems, focusing on applications such as smart home care systems and sensor development for medical diagnostics. He currently serves as a Lecturer in Computer Engineering at Khon Kaen University, where he contributes to the education of future engineers and researchers. Dr. Srichan’s work has been recognized with honors such as the Lucent Technology Scholarship, DAAD-SIEMENS scholarship, and grants from institutions like the US National Institute of Health (NIH) and Japan NICT through the ASEAN IVO Project for sensor development.
